Started the day with my usual breakfast. I left Sharon in Santo Domingo where she would catch a bus to Viloria de Rioja, our lodging for the night. I didn't have a long walk ahead of me... Maybe a little more than 9 miles and it was an easy walk....no lung bursting climbs. It was cloudy and a steady light rain, but not at all cold. That is until the heavens opened up and dumped on us. Talk about a lot of wet peregrinos! However, I bet not a single one would have wanted to be any where else. In that kind of rain, nothing will keep you dry. I was glad to see Viloria de Rioja appear in the distance and my pace picked up..I so wanted to be here. However, I did not expect what I found...a refugio so warm and so welcoming. The inviting living room with overstuffed chairs & sofas and a fire burning, incense burning and beautiful music softly playing. The sleeping area has 10 beds and a fire burning. The dining area with a big table encouraging peregrinos to eat together. It is indeed magic! We are warm, dry and content. Sharon arrived safely. We are bout to plan our day tomorrow. She will walk and see how her leg feels. I hope it's better. Send positive, healing thoughts her way.
